Company Profile
Takara Leben Real Estate Investment Corporation (TLR) was list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ange Real Estate Investment Trust Securities Market on July 27, 2018. TLR is a diversified J-REIT that has companies boasting expertise and know-how backed by an extensive track record in office, residential, hotel, retail and other properties - Takara Leben Co., Ltd., PAG Investment Management Limited, Kyoritsu Maintenance Co., Ltd. and Yamada Denki Co., Ltd.- as sponsors. TLR aims to realize "steady growth" and "stable management" by utilizing a multi-sponsor management structure that combines the expertise and know-how of each of the sponsors, which boast different strengths. In addition, TLR aims to realize "maximization of unitholder value," "creation of a sustainable environment" and "contribution to communities and society" in order to remain the unitholders' diversified J-REIT of choice.
